On Monday, Janelle earned $16 for 2 hours of babysitting. getting paid the same rate, she earned $40 for babysitting on Saturday. how many hours did Janelle babysit on friday.

First you take $16 divided by 2 and get $8 so we know she gets paid $8 per hour. Then you will take the $40 divided by $8 to get 5 hours
